top of page
.png)
Red Rebels Toronto


Red Rebels Protest Canada Pension Plan at Weekly Vigil
The Red Rebels are holding a vigil outside the Canada Pension Plan Investment Board (CPPIB) every Thursday from 12 to 1 PM, and you're...
Jul 21, 2025
bottom of page